(SUNfoto by Lindsey Bright) James Biggs moves and shapes the sand to form the mountains and valleys. Biggs is working on a state-of-the-art Sim Table which is used in emergency training situations. Biggs, though, is using it for education in fuels management, wildland firefighting, fire ecology and hydrology. Biggs is the first professor in the nation to use the Sim Table for teaching college courses. He teaches at Northern New Mexico College’s El Rito campus.
